The majority of Spelling Mastery students will answer most of the items correctly because of the program’s instructional philosophy, resulting in high scores but little … WebCriterion-referenced tests are used to measure knowledge or skills. The child’s score is based on mastery of the material and is usually expressed as a percentage. Teachers use criterion-referenced tests to determine if students have mastered material. Classroom spelling and math tests are criterion-referenced tests.
